Elephant & Castle station offers a selection of facilities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. The ticket office at the station is open from morning till evening, with varied hours on weekends, ensuring there is plenty of time to purchase or collect your tickets, which can be done conveniently at one of the accessible ticket machines. If you're planning to use a smartcard for an even easier experience, you'll be pleased to find validators ready for use at the station.
For those in need of assistance or information, staff support is available with helpful staff ready to assist until late at night. While the station does not offer step-free access or wheelchair availability, it does provide seating areas for passengers waiting for their trains. CCTV ensures safety throughout the premises, while amenities such as restrooms, ATM facilities, and refreshment options are also offered, set to make your wait more comfortable.
As for onward travel from Elephant & Castle, you have a plethora of options. The station is well connected with local bus services facilitating travel across London. For detailed planning, refer to the 'Onward Travel Information Map' available at the station. Although there are no dedicated cycle hire facilities or bicycle storage, the station is easily accessible via public transportation, ensuring smooth travel post your arrival.

Liverpool Central Station is equipped to meet a variety of passenger needs. The ticket office operates from early morning until late at night, ensuring travelers can purchase or collect tickets conveniently. Ticket machines are available but do note that they are not designed for accessible use. For those utilizing smartcards, issuance is possible at the station, although validators are not currently available.
Accessibility is a prime focus at Liverpool Central, ensuring step-free access throughout the station. While there are no dedicated parking facilities, visitors can take advantage of accessible toilets and waiting areas. Staff assistance is readily available every day of the week for those who need it, adding an extra layer of support for all passengers.
The station features several refreshment and shopping options. Whether you need to grab a quick bite from a vending machine or pick up some essentials from the variety of shops housed on site, such as a convenience store or even a shoe repair service, Liverpool Central has got you covered. An ATM is also available for any immediate cash needs.
Navigating to and from Liverpool Central is straightforward. Rail replacement services, if needed, can be found at 32 Great Charlotte Street, just moments away from the station. For local travels, comprehensive bus routes are available, with detailed travel information provided by Merseytravel or by contacting Traveline.
For those needing to reach Liverpool John Lennon Airport, there's a convenient rail/bus ticket option from any Merseyrail station to the airport, courtesy of the 86A or 80A buses departing from Liverpool South Parkway station, arriving at the airport within a short 10-minute ride.
